CISE 422 Intelligent Controllers

الموضوع في 'تقييم المقررات الدراسية - CISE' بواسطة تقييم, بتاريخ ‏15 فبراير 2012.

  1. تقييم

    تقييم مشرف
    طاقم الإدارة

    انضم:
    ‏30 أكتوبر 2008
    المشاركات:
    2,452
    التخصص:
    N/A
    الجامعة:
    N/A
    سنة التخرج:
    N/A
    التقييمات:
    +28 / 1 / -6
    هذا الموضوع مخصص لمناقشة المقرر المذكور في العنوان
    بنود تساعد في تقييم المقرر:

    جودة المقرر بشكل عام
    المواضيع التي يغطيها المقرر
    الكتاب المستخدم للمقرر
    الأسئلة والأمثلة المستخدمة في المقرر
    مدى فائدته في الناحية التطبيقية​

    ولكم الحرية في تقييم المقرر باستحداث بنود أخرى ترونها مناسبه لتقييمه.

    كما نرجو تحري الصدق والعدل في تقييم المقرر
    وعدم الخلط بين تقييم الأستاذ وتقييم المقرر بذاته
     
  2. Ali G

    Ali G عضو

    انضم:
    ‏11 نوفمبر 2018
    المشاركات:
    15
    التخصص:
    EE
    الجامعة:
    KFUPM
    سنة التخرج:
    2019
    الجنس:
    ذكر
    الإقامة:
    السعودية
    التقييمات:
    +9 / 0 / -2
    #2 Ali G, ‏6 يناير 2020
    آخر تعديل: ‏6 يناير 2020
    مع Dr. Muhammad Mysorewala في ترم 191

    جودة المقرر بشكل عام:

    المقرر صراحة جدا مرتب ومنظم وهذي من عادات الدكتور محمد.

    المواضيع التي يغطيها المقرر:
    20% (Major 1)

    اول خطوة في المقرر راح تاخذ مقدمة عن Intelligent controllers مثل Fuzzy logic و Neural Network و اخر شيء عن شغلة Expert PID. ركز اكثر على Expert PID>> في حقيقة كنت جاهل بمعرفتي عن PID كنت متوقع عبارة عن ثوابت من Kd,Kp,Ki وما يتغيرون. لا الحين انت كمهندس تحكم لك الحرية انك تغيرهم بناءاً على Error. مثال اذا كان error كبير, خلي Kp صغير>> واذا صار error صغير تقدر تحط kp كبير عشان تتجنب Overshoot. برضو ركز على Fuzzy >> راح تأخذ نبذة بسيط عنه.
    ويتكون Fuzzy من ثلاث مراحل مهمة: Fuzzification>> ثم If Then Rules>> واخر شيء Defuzzification.

    20% (Major 2)
    في هذا القسم راح تركز على Fuzzy logic. اول شيء خلينا نفهم وش يعني Fuzzy وليش نحتاجه :/:؟؟ لو سألت وش درجة الحرارة الغرفة الحين؟ ممكن تكون معتدل الجو او البرودة خفيفة وهذي تسمى Fuzziness. فعقلك عنده اكثر من رأى طيب وش اسوي ارفع المكيف ولا اخفضه :sudden:. فكرت Fuzzy يعدل بين الرأيين ويعدل المكيف على مزاجك. فهو عبارة عن محاكاة عقل انسان اذا عند اكثر من لوقيك في نظامك كيف يقدر يعطيك افضل اوتبت.

    20% (Major 3)

    بعد ما تفهم فكرة Fuzzy وكيف تطبقه في الواقع نسأل نفسنا وش يفيديني هذا في الكنترول؟ الجواب يقدر يخلي الكنترولر Adaptive بمعنى ثاني Kd,Kp,Ki يتغير بناءا على error وهذا اضافة جدا قوية للنظام اذا هو Adaptive, طبعا ما راح اتكلم عن الكونسبت وكيف هذي الشيء يصير تقدر تشوف من السلايدات من الرابط.
    بعدها راح تأخذ نبذة عن Neural Network (هذا امتع قسم في المادة) وهو عبارة عن محاكاة عقل الانسان في
    التعلم. في البداية كنت تسوي مودلينق باستخدام Laplace, سويت ل DC motor شوف كم اخذ منك وقت تطلع مودل لنظام جدا بسيط زي موتر فما بالك للروبوت او سيارة, باقي Airplane :hahaha: (بالتوفيق). ولكن شكرا ل Neural Network جمع له بيانات وهو يضبطك مودل على شكل Matrix (علاقة بين انبت و اوتبت) مهما كان النظام معقد وغير عن كذا يسوي مودل كل فترة وتسمى ب Online Learning.

    20% (Final)
    في نوع ثاني من Neural Network تستخدم في Image Procesing انه كيف يقدر يقولك هذا في الصورة بيض او خبز(شكلي جيعان:hehehe:)؟ فالكاميرا يشوف الصورة بلغة Matrix. تقدر تعرف الفرق بينهم باستخدام integration في اكثر من طريقة تقدر تفرق بينهم للمعلومة. اول شيء تجمع بيانات عن الاغراض الي تبي تصنفهم وتقول هذا خبز وهو يجمع بيانات عن مساحة وشكله, بعدين تروح للعصير وتسوي نفس الشيء. في نهاية يطلع شكلهم على Normal distribution.
    UcOHy.png
    واخر شيء تخش في عالم ثاني والي هو دمج بين Fuzzy وNeural Network وهنا جمعت Learning و Adaptive وتخلي نظام تقريبا متكامل ومن الامثلة ANFIS.

    الكتاب المستخدم للمقرر:
    (لا يوجد كتاب).

    الأسئلة والأمثلة المستخدمة في المقرر:
    في امثلة في سلايدات الدكتور ولكن الصعوبة المقرر ما تقدر تحصل امثلة غيرها عشان تجهز للاختبارات ولكن انصحك تركز مع الدكتور وما راح تحصل مشاكل في الاختبارات.

    مدى فائدته في الناحية التطبيقية:
    ما ادري من وين ابدأ واتكلم عن تطبيقات لانها جدا واسعة. مثلا السيارة الكنترولر حقك مثبت السرعة اذا صر لك حادث لو ما سمح الله راح تشوف مثبت السرعة يخبط بعد الحادث فتحتاج ترجع لميكانيكي عشان يعدل الكنترولر ولكن باستخدام Neuro Fuzzy تقدر تقول مثبت السرعة يكون شغال وبروضو الكنترولر يتعلم ويحدث الكنترولر من نفسه. وبرضو في مجال الروبوتيكس اصعب شيء تواجه اذا تبي تصمم كنترولر, وعشان تصمم كنترولر تحتاج المودل باستخدام Machine Learning. وايضا في مجال Image processing باستخدام Unsupervised Learning. والي ذكرته مجرد 5% من تطبيقاته.

    إضافات:
    1- الحضور عليه 5% .
    2-الواجبات عليه 15% بعضها طويلة وتحتاج جهد عالي.
    3- تحتاج ماتلاب كثيرة حتى في الواجب.
    4-الدكتور يتفنن في التركات:blow: عاد هذا مجاله في الكورس.
    5- بنسبي لي كان الكورس يأخذ مني جهد عالي ومستواه advance, لكن اتوقع يختلف لطلاب الكنترول.
    6-الكورس حاليا اشوف فائدته للقسم الابحاث, اذا تبي تكمل درساتك ينصحك تنزله.
    7-الصعوبة الحقيقة في التطبيق وليس مجرد الفهم الكونسبت وخلاص. اذا عندك روبوت وتبي تدخله مع Fuzzy هنا الاختبار الحقيقي لك.

    ملفات:
    CISE 422-191
     
جاري تحميل الصفحة...
مواضيع شبيهة - CISE 422 Intelligent Controllers
  1. s2012055
    الردود:
    6
    المشاهدات:
    1,029
  2. mohannd
    الردود:
    0
    المشاهدات:
    770
  3. تقييم
    الردود:
    2
    المشاهدات:
    2,911
  4. helloZiad
    الردود:
    0
    المشاهدات:
    1,216
  5. GoldenFrog
    الردود:
    0
    المشاهدات:
    602
  6. تقييم
    الردود:
    0
    المشاهدات:
    656
  7. تقييم
    الردود:
    0
    المشاهدات:
    746
  8. تقييم
    الردود:
    3
    المشاهدات:
    2,329
  9. سين من الناس
    الردود:
    0
    المشاهدات:
    748
  10. Mechanical Boy
    الردود:
    3
    المشاهدات:
    817

مشاركة هذه الصفحة